CUDAHY, Wis. (CBS 58) -- Community support continues for fallen Milwaukee Police Officer Kendall Corder.
The Cudahy-St. Francis Little League Association held a fundraiser for his family Monday night.
The group is holding their World Series game, and before things got started, they held a moment of silence for Corder, who was killed in a shooting two weeks ago.
"I worked out with him in the weight room, I powerlifted with him," said Ryan Zankl, vice president of the Cudahy-St. Francis Little League Baseball Association. "It's the least we can do, to raise money for his family."
